We are looking for a Welder to join our Whale Family! 

Reporting to the Tank Shift Supervisor, you will work in a team environment to complete the tank build process.

We are looking for a team member who has experience in the Welding industry including both Mild and Stainless Steel and understands the relevant legislation and procedures to ensure that out tanks are welded to the required standard.

What you will your responsibilities be: 

  • Completing the tank build process 

  • Work to standard operating procedures and engineering data sheets to complete the welding process

  • Work in accordance with Whale Health and Safety policies and maintain a safe working environment 

  • Communicate effectively with members of the team to ensure that the process runs smoothly 

  • Ensure that your work area is well maintained, clean and organised 

We are looking for someone who is / has 

  • It is ESSENTIAL that you have MIG welding experience in both Mild and Stainless steel at various thicknesses 

  • Pipe welding experience would be desirable

  • A background of working in a production environment

  • The ability to understand SOPs to assemble components for our tankers

  • Methodical and organised with good communication skills

  • It would be an advantage if you have a forklift and overhead crane licence 

This role will require the successful candidate to pass multiple welder qualifications
